Sadler’s Breck
Sadler’s Breck is a forest in Carburton, Bassetlaw, England. Sadler’s Breck is situated nearby to the locality Hazel Gap, as well as near the hamlet Carburton.Places of Interest

Sherwood Forest
Nature reserve
Photo: Javier Carro,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Sherwood Forest in Nottinghamshire is the last surviving tract of primeval forest in England. In medieval times it was a royal hunting forest – the shire or sher wood of Nottinghamshire – and it became the setting for the legend of Robin Hood.

Major Oak
Photo: Galli, Public domain.
The Major Oak is a large English oak near Edwinstowe in the midst of Sherwood Forest, Nottinghamshire, England. According to local folklore, it was Robin Hood's shelter where he and his Merry Men slept.

Market Warsop
Town
Photo: Dave Bevis,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Market Warsop is a town within the civil parish of Warsop in Mansfield District, Nottinghamshire, England, on the outskirts of the remnants of Sherwood Forest.
Norton
Village
Photo: BulldozerD11,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Norton is a village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Norton, Cuckney, Holbeck and Welbeck, in the Bassetlaw district, in the county of Nottinghamshire, England.
